FLORENCE, S.C. – Area high school students competed in the third-annual Foreign Language Declamation Competition hosted by the Francis Marion University Department of English, Modern Languages and Philosophy on Oct. 8.
More than 100 students from 18 high schools competed in French, Spanish and Latin. Participating schools were Cardinal Newman High School, Johnsonville High School, Crestwood High School, Trinity Collegiate School, Darlington High School, Marlboro County High School, Lake View High School, Hannah-Pamplico High School, Emmanuel Baptist School, Wilson High School, South Florence High School, West Florence High School, Marion High School, Pee Dee Academy, Mayo High School for Math, Science and Technology; The Byrnes Schools, Avalon Academy, and Timmonsville High School.
Contestants were required to recite two selections: one mandatory selection and a second chosen from three selections. The students were judged on memorization, pronunciation and enunciation, phraseology, natural gestures and appropriate movement, and delivery. First-, second- and third-place prizes were presented at an awards ceremony.
